  1. Synopsis. A miller, a weaver and a tailor lived in King Arthur's time (or in "Good Old Colonial times"). They were thrown out because they could not sing. All three were thieves. They are suitably punished. The Miller got drowned in a dam. The Weaver got hung in his yarn. The Tailor tripped as he ran away with the broadcloth under his arm.
